What is trading card game design?

Trading card game design is the process of creating the rules, mechanics, cards, and overall structure of a collectible or trading card game (TCG). Designers develop the gameplay experience, balancing strategy, randomness, and player interaction. They also work on themes, artwork, and expansions to keep the game engaging and fresh. Successful trading card game design requires creativity, playtesting, and a deep understanding of what makes games fun and replayable.

What are some common challenges faced by trading card game designers during the playtesting phase?

Trading card game designers often encounter challenges in balancing the gameplay and ensuring that no single card or strategy dominates the game. Playtesting requires designers to collect and analyze feedback from a diverse group of players, which can reveal unforeseen interactions or exploits. Additionally, designers must iterate quickly and thoughtfully, adjusting card mechanics and rules while maintaining the overall vision of the game. Collaboration with artists, developers, and marketing teams is also crucial to align the game's mechanics with its thematic and commercial goals.
